If you have a strong spiritual side, or if your spiritual leanings are beginning to surface, or if you have a healthy curiosity about the spiritual side - then this is one book that you cannot do without!
Admittedly, this book isnt for everybody. If spirituality bores you, or if you like your spirituality in simple(even over-simplified), condensed, easy-to-remember prose likeThe Monk Who Sold His Ferrari, then you may not like this book. It needs some concentration, yes, it can be heavy reading at times - and some of the concepts are indeed difficult to grasp. It certainly helps if one has already read Swami Vivekananda and Shri Aurobindo, but that is not a compulsion.
But enough caveats for now!
If this book is for you, the value that you will derive from it is immeasurable! You will return to it a hundred times, sometimes only to your favourite chapters or paragraphs but occasionally to revisit the entire book from cover to cover.
Each reader will have his/her favourite portions; mine are:
The Law of Miracles - and the simplicity with which Yogananda has demystified the subject
The idea that there is a particular time in your life when your spiritual quest begins; you cannot force it to happen earlier.
The fascinating account pertaining to the Legend of Maha Avtar Babaji
The idea that Karma is a bunch of unfulfilled desires - not sins that one must atone for
The idea that Death is just a doorway - to another dimension, another plane, another form of energy vibrating at a different frequency
